How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sandia Heights?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Sandia Heights Studio Apartments | $1,061 | $999 | $1,405 |
Sandia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,522 | $1,108 | $2,920 |
Sandia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,824 | $1,246 | $3,350 |
Sandia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,395 | $1,699 | $3,570 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Sandia Heights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Sandia Heights?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Sandia Heights with Washer/Dryer is at Treehouse Apartments listed at $999.
How much is the average rent for Sandia Heights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Sandia Heights with Washer/Dryer is $1,715.
What is the largest Sandia Heights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Sandia Heights is a 1,669 square feet unit starting from $1,595 at Las Kivas Apartments.
What is the average size for Sandia Heights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Sandia Heights is currently at 701 sq ft.
